    Abstract: The present invention belongs to the field of tumor immunotherapy, and relates to a humanized anti-VEGF antibody Fab fragment. The present invention discloses nucleic acid sequences (including heavy/light chain variable regions) encoding said antibody fragment, and vectors, pharmaceutical compositions and kits containing said nucleic acid sequences. The anti-VEGF antibody Fab fragments disclosed in the present invention can specifically bind to VEGF with high affinity and block the binding of VEGF to the receptor VEGFR2, and also neutralize the proliferative effect of VEGF on HUVEC cells. Compared to the full-length antibody, antibodies in the form of Fab fragments have stronger penetrability and less toxic in terms of gastrointestinal perforation, hypertension and hemorrhage and do not stimulate the complement cascade reaction, thus reducing the risk of endophthalmitis and autoimmune inflammatory reactions.

    Abstract: A system is provided in the present disclosure. The system may determine a first exposure time of a visible light sensor of an image acquisition device according to ambient light at a scene to be photographed. The image acquisition device may include the visible light sensor and an infrared light sensor. The system may also actuate the image acquisition device to simultaneously capture a visible light image and at least one infrared light image of the scene. The visible light image may be captured using a visible light sensor with the first exposure time. The at least one infrared light image may be captured using an infrared light sensor. The system may also generate a WDR image by processing the at least one infrared light image, and generate a target image of the scene by fusing the visible light image and the WDR image.
